Featured in Manchester Evening News article

I was recently interviewed for the Manchester Evening News about our fundraising walk along Hadrian’s Wall.

A granny is preparing to walk the entire length of Hadrian’s wall – to raise cash for a special school and encourage other Muslims to support local charities.

Rifat Saleem, 57, hopes to raise £10,000 for the Seashell Trust in Cheadle by trekking 84 miles from Bowness-on-Solway to Wallsend, Newcastle.

Mrs Saleem, from Hale, decided to support the special school after learning about the work that it does with students with communication difficulties.
